No upgrade to Joomla 4 from site with J3
Hi, previously on a J 3 site I saw the possibility of upgrading to J 4, now I don't.
All Joomla plugins related to the update are active and there are no problems with the DB (other sites with the same settings, I have updated them). Does anyone know why this happens?
Thanks for your help

Re: No upgrade to Joomla 4 from site with J3
Mod. Note: Relocated topic to the Upgrade Forum.
Are you on the Joomla Next Channel? Check the Options in the Upgrade Component.

Re: No upgrade to Joomla 4 from site with J3
SOLVED
For some strange reason, by deactivating and reactivating related plugins and extensions a few times, you see the possibility of updating (migrating) to J 4
Thanks anyway for your interest
